This go-karting centre is situated in the Parc de Loisirs in Capbreton, 25 km from Messanges. Go-karts for adults, children and two-seaters are available for hire on an 828-metre track. Children’s karts (120m³) and 270m³ karts for adults. 10-minute sessions with lap times provided.

How the activity works
1️⃣ Reception and facilities
- Venue: Leisure park on Boulevard des Cigales, with a 1,000-metre outdoor track.
- Equipment provided: helmets (sizes XXS to XXL), wetsuits (if required), and hygiene caps.
- Required attire: closed-toe shoes compulsory; close-fitting clothing (no scarves or loose-fitting garments).
2️⃣ Go-kart options
- Children’s karts: 120m³ mini-karts suitable for children aged 7 and over and at least 1m35 tall.
- Adult karts: 270m³, with the option of two-seaters.
- Safety: compulsory briefing on how the karts work and the safety rules (keeping a safe distance, no contact).
3️⃣ Driving session
- Technical circuit: straights, tight bends and safe overtaking points.
- Supervision: track marshal equipped with a remote control to slow down or stop the karts in the event of danger.
- Please note: children and adults may sometimes be on the track together.
